WebThis “waiting period” will be reimbursed if you miss more than two weeks as a result of your injury. Temporary Total Disability (TTD) TTD is due if the doctor takes you completely off of work or if the doctor gives you restrictions that your employer cannot accommodate. WebFeb 3, 2024 · Workers’ compensation waiting periods. A workers’ compensation “waiting period” is the number of days an employee must be off work before receiving wage-loss benefits. Colorado defines a workweek as a fixed and recurring period of 168 hours which is equivalent to seven (7) consecutive twenty-four (24) hour periods. The seven day period that forms the workweek must start on the same calendar day and at the same hour each week.
